Sooo, I have realized that I might be tolerating too much breakage. I have noticed little 2-3 inch hair, especially around my hair line. I have the feeling that my breakage was coming from 1) My rollerclips,sometimes I get them tangled up, 2) Bad night protecting habits, 3) Different textures in my head. I wash and deep condition twice a week like clock work so I decided that maybe I need a strong protien treatment. I used Aphogee and I liked it. My hair felt super soft after rinsing and I followed it up with a mositurizing conditioner for 20-30mins. Well to make a long story short, I still have breakage. I know it is not going to stop dead in its tracks but :eek:, What do I do now? Was my Aphogee old? Did I not use enough?

I recently did a cheapy CON, daily for 5 days (no time to wash), no rinsing, just slathered it on, smoothed my hair back, wiped excess away with a cloth, bunned and went. I finally got the chance to rinse, in the shower after those 5 days, now I have a head of baby hair, no shedding (i did not comb either, it was truly tangle free), applied scurl, smoothed, bunned, tied down, and let dry 80% overnight. This morning back to the bun, no combing, after applying jojoba oil, scurl, a moisturizer, a good oil, and some silicon (proclaim glossing polish), I wont be combing my hair for another week, just adding scurl, moussse( a newbie product)and smooth, when it starts getting grunge and buildup, i'll apply the cheapy CON for 2 days, then shampoo out, restore the pH get rid of buildup with ACV, and start all over.
